I am faced with almost every nightmare scenario such as weak bass drum hits, low (insecure) vocals, buzzing guitar amps, etc. I will be honest, this project usually takes all my engineering skills to eke out a decent sound from these tracks. As you can imagine, the quality of tone, consistency and performances, well let’s just say, vary greatly from band to band and even from song to song! After the initial recording is done, I take the recorded tracks into my studio and mix them using my DAW and plugins so they can be married to a video of their performance, which is given to the kids and posted on the web. I am hired to record a local music school’s “School of Rock” showcase at a local venue. Now the first project I tried these plugins on was one of my “Problem Child” projects that I get every couple months. The upside was if they were not something I could or would use, I can just cancel and only be out a couple bucks. So, when Slate started offering the “Everything Bundle” I figured what the hell, for $15 bucks a month or the cost of a couple of Starbucks Coffee’s I can try out all the plugs in the collection to see if I would even use them. I was always curious about Slate Digital’s other plugins, but like I said earlier I have become more conservative in my plugin purchases. The fact is this plugin collection gave my mixes so much warmth and character, I ended up having the plugin on every track as part of my normal template when starting a new session.
From this beginning the pair went on to pioneer the creation of analog modeled plugins from Virtual tape machines, console emulations, compressors, eq’s etc.Ī few years ago I purchased the Virtual Console Collection to use on my channels and for adding an analog summing feel.
This innovative plugin was employed a new method of creating perceived loudness without sacrificing the Dynamic Range of the music. Their first product was the award winning FG-X Mastering plugin suite, which was specifically designed to combat the Loudness vs Dynamic range war. In 2008 Steven Slate met DSP designer Fabrice Gabriel at an AES convention and the pair teamed up to create Slate Digital.
